| description | Be short of well-defined networks boundaries, shared medium, collaborative services,
and dynamic nature, all are representing some of the key characteristics that
distinguish mobile ad hoc networks from the conventional ones. Besides, each node is
a possible part of the essential support infrastructure, cooperate with each other to
make basic communication services available. Forwarding packets or participating in
routing process, either of each can directly affect the network security state.
Nevertheless, ad hoc networks are suspectable to the same vulnerabilities and prone to
the same types of failures as conventional networks. Even though immune-inspired
approaches aren’t essentially new to the research domain, the percentage of applying
immune features in solving security problems fluctuates. In this paper, security
approach based on both immunity and multi-agent paradigm is presented.
Distributability, second response, and self recovery, are the hallmarks of the proposed
security model which put a consideration on high nodes mobility. |
